Job Purpose:

Manage the delivery of payroll processes, the team responsible for those activities, leading future migrations, supporting country and global projects and ensuring KPIs are met. Focus is on:

  • Driving success of HR model, focused on providing inputs and solution to effectively manage end to end Payroll processing, administration of all relevant tax and social security payments and reporting, management and oversight of the end to end controls framework involving the Pay People process.
  • Continuously improving and documenting payroll processes, proactively addressing end to end HR/Payroll process gaps and unlocking potential as well as productivity partnering with various business stakeholders.
  • Supporting implementation of Shell’s HR Transformation Journey.
  • Represent Payroll SBO as part of the wider HR agenda by collaborating with key stakeholders such as HR Operations, HR, Tax, Legal, IT and Payroll Accounting.
  • Supporting and Advising Regional Payroll Managers and Country Payroll Managers to build further synergies, collaborations and strategies enabling Shell’s business objectives through flexibility, simplicity and actionable insights.

Principal Accountabilities:

1. Payroll Operations Management

  • Responsible for delivery of end to end Malaysia Payroll Processes and support Shell's Payroll compliance across an increasingly complex statutory and regulatory landscape working across Country HR, Policy, Tax, Legal, IT and Finance to meet business objectives and realizing defined business value.
  • Accountable for advice to the Payroll team and business partners in managing more complex HR/Payroll queries and projects including support country 3rd party contract implementations relating to external service providers.
  • Always ensure all Financial Control Manual and Data Privacy Rules are accurately executed to fully address the business risk in an environment with high monetary materiality and safeguard from Data Privacy breaches.
  • Translate business requirements into system solutions like SAP, Workday, Assignment Pro with Functional Leads and Payroll Specialists to meet Shell business obligations and implementation of Global Payroll Strategy.
  • Effective and timely issue management ensuring all stakeholders are well informed/consulted, risk contained, and long-term solutions put in place.

2. Lead and Manage

  • Lead and manage a team of 4 to 7 Payroll Analysts.
  • Manage dynamic people agenda by providing leadership support and coaching to team including regular one to ones, meaningful IDP conversations, goal setting, actively manage succession planning and building Global Payroll Capabilities.
  • Ensure all KPIs defined for the team are met, and team members are equipped with the knowledge, skills and support to perform accurate, timely and compliant pay at high standards.
  • Continuously improve the performance of the team and the services provided through embedding of applicable skills and behaviours. Utilize data and look for opportunities like data analytics to improve and refine ways of working.

3. Continuous Improvement

  • Embed continuous improvement in E2E processes, to drive operational excellence, standardization and harmonization by optimizing Continuous Improvement tools such as visual management, leader standard work and waste elimination.
  • Collaborate with broader HR operations and country stakeholders to deliver greater impact at less costs through continuous improvement, continue to introduce simpler process and enhanced employee experiences.
  • Build a culture of continuous improvement to deliver better results, improve systems and processes to support future growth of the business and remove roadblocks to team members execution.

4. Business Partnership

  • Establish strong working relationships within HR model (i.e. HROPS include International Mobility, Country HRM’s, Country Payroll Managers, Policy teams, Finance Operations, IT, Treasury/E-banking, 3rd party service providers.
  • Liaise regularly with business stakeholders to ensure the team has access to all relevant information to perform effectively in their roles.
  • Represent SBO Payroll on local HR/Payroll team forums and put the employee and key stakeholders at the heart of process to create an exceptional employee experience through pay delivery.

5. Leadership

  • Deliver Global Payroll Strategy objectives and manage significant change journey over the coming years.
  • Periodically review payroll process performance identify patterns, themes and linkages in areas of improvement and deliver internal reviews in alignment with business partners.
  • Acts as a coach/mentor. Leads by example.

Key Challenges:

  1. Strong leadership experience is required to drive team performance improvements and coach Functional Leads and Payroll Specialists for their personal effectiveness regarding engagement and competing priorities.
  2. Manage risks and issues for the relevant process areas and plan delivery in line with Global Payroll Strategy and standards.
  3. Full understanding of rapid & often complex changing governmental regulations can create differences in countries compensation requirements.
  4. Data Privacy: Ensuring personal and sensitive data is appropriately managed and protected at all points in the E2E payroll process. Building and embedding collaborative ways of working across the integrated E2E payroll process working across multiple countries and functions
